Uses

N,N'-Diphenylbenzidine is an indicator suitable for redox titrations, e.g. with dichromate or cerium(IV) sulfate 1,2. It is also used as intermediates in organic synthesis.

Synthesis

The synthesis of N,N'-Diphenylbenzidine is as follows:
3.12 g (10mmol) of 4,4'-dibromodiphenyl, 2.3 mL (25 mmol) of aniline, 2.9 g (30 mmol) of t-BuONa, 183 mg (0.2 mmol) of Pd2(dba)3, and 20 mg (0.1 mmol) of P(t-Bu)3 were dissolved in 30 mL of toluene, and then stirred at 90°C for 3 hrs. The reaction mixture was cooled to room temperature and three times extracted with distilled water and diethyl ether. Precipitates in an organic layer were filtered, washed with acetone and diethyl ether, and then dried in vacuum to obtain 0.3g of the intermediate compound C (yield: 90%). 

Purification Methods

Crystallise the benzidine from toluene or ethyl acetate. Store it in the dark. [Beilstein 13 H 223, 13 IV 368.]
